RMV
rvmtransport
integration集成将 Home Assistant 与您的设备、服务等连接和集成。 [Learn more] 将为您提供莱茵-美因地区公共交通网络中下一个车站或停靠点的下一班公交车、有轨电车、地铁或火车的出发时间。额外的细节如线路号和目的地会在属性中显示。
设置
访问 RMV OpenData网站
配置
要启用此integration集成将 Home Assistant 与您的设备、服务等连接和集成。 [Learn more],请将以下行添加到您的configuration.yaml
configuration.yaml 文件是 Home Assistant 的主要配置文件。它列出了要加载的集成及其特定配置。在某些情况下,需要直接在 configuration.yaml 文件中手动编辑配置。大多数集成可以在 UI 中配置。 [Learn more]文件中。
在更改了configuration.yaml
configuration.yaml 文件是 Home Assistant 的主要配置文件。它列出了要加载的集成及其特定配置。在某些情况下,需要直接在 configuration.yaml 文件中手动编辑配置。大多数集成可以在 UI 中配置。 [Learn more] 文件后,重启 Home Assistant 以应用更改。 该集成现在显示在集成页面的 设置 > 设备与服务 下。其实体在集成卡片上以及实体标签上列出。
# 示例 configuration.yaml 条目
sensor:
- platform: rmvtransport
next_departure:
- station: STATION_OR_STOP_ID
Configuration Variables
一个或多个出发传感器。
一个或多个终点名称,例如 ‘Frankfurt (Main) Hauptbahnhof’ 或 [‘Frankfurt (Main) Hauptbahnhof’,‘Frankfurt (Main) Stadion’]。这可以仅用于考虑特定的行驶方向。
一种或多种交通方式 ['U-Bahn', 'Tram', 'Bus', 'S', 'RB', 'RE', 'EC', 'IC', 'ICE']
。
[“U-Bahn”, “Tram”, “Bus”, “S”, “RB”, “RE”, “EC”, “IC”, “ICE”]
示例
完整配置
下面的示例显示了一个包含三个传感器的完整配置,展示了各种配置选项。
# 示例 configuration.yaml 条目
sensor:
- platform: rmvtransport
scan_interval: 120
timeout: 10
next_departure:
- station: 3000010
time_offset: 5
destinations:
- 'Frankfurt (Main) Flughafen Regionalbahnhof'
- 'Frankfurt (Main) Stadion'
products:
- 'RB'
- 'RE'
- 'Bus'
- 'S'
- station: 3006907
products: "Bus"
destinations: ['Wiesbaden Dernsches Gelände', 'Mainz Hauptbahnhof']
name: 目的地
- station: 3006904
lines: "S8"
max_journeys: 5
products: "S"
第一个传感器将返回从法兰克福中央车站到法兰克福机场或体育场的S-Bahn、公交车、RB和RE列车出发时间,时间至少为5分钟后。
第二个传感器返回从威斯巴登中央车站开往Dernsches Gelände和美因茨中央车站的公交车出发时间。要检索第二个出发时间,您可以使用 state_attr('sensor.ENTITY_NAME', 'departures')[1].time
。
第三个传感器返回从美因茨中央车站出发的所有S-Bahn列车,线路为S8。